Hannibal Mejbri should have been handed more game time, feels Tim Sherwood Tim Sherwood has slammed Manchester United boss Erik ten Hag for his treatment of Hannibal Mejbri and has hit out at the club’s so-called ‘superstars’. Hannibal Mejbri scored in Man Utd’s Premier League loss to Brighton last month ‘Say what you want about him and people will say, ‘He’s not a £100m player, he’s not this or that’ – but he went to Birmingham, worked hard on loan there, he came back and for me, he was Man of the Match in a couple games. ‘But as soon as someone else is fit, he is out the door. Sit on the bench, son. Someone else comes in and strolls around the pitch, doesn’t want to run around or get the ball back.
